Adrien Brody in for "The Courier"

by Jane Boursaw on October 27th, 2008

Adrien Brody has signed to play the lead in “The Courier,” an action tale directed by Russell Mulcahy for Arclight Films.

Brody has had such an interesting film career, everything from “King Kong” to “The Darjeeling Limited” to his current films, “Cadillac Records” and “The Brothers Bloom.”

He hasn’t really taken the “commercial” road to success, but it’s found him nonetheless. And he doesn’t really look like a movie star either, for that matter, but that makes him all the more appealing to me.

“The Courier” should be interesting, because it’s written by Michael Brandt and Derek Haas, who contributed to “Wanted” and “3:10 to Yuma” (one of my favorite movies of 2007). The story centers on a daredevil courier trying to deliver a briefcase to an underworld figure who can’t be found. Just the sort of thing Brody can sink his acting chops into.
